FULL BODIED LIFE DRAWING w Felicity Lovett

 

The human form is at once very familiar, and quite mysterious. It therefore presents one of the most enjoyable, challenging, and beautiful subjects for artists. Drawing the human body from life also helps develop fluency in the visual language used in all artwork and is a highly valuable practice for artists of all media.  

This series of workshops introduces participants to life drawing via a range of technique building exercises and opportunities to produce fully realised drawings with a variety of drawing media.  While life drawing can be a challenge, these workshops are suitable for all skill-levels and are designed to strengthen your ability to ‘see clearly and make clearly’.

 

WEEK 1: FORM

This workshop acts as a warm-up, familiarising participants with the structure of the body and methods for accurately describing proportion, mass, and gesture. We will work with a range of poses ranging from very short to moderate length, exploring a range of actions and movement.

WEEK 2: LIGHT AND TEXTURE

This workshop focuses on the play of light and dark. We will explore a range of drawing activities that highlight the three-dimensionality of the figure via the structuring of shadow, mid-tones, and highlights, with different materials and application techniques.

WEEK 3: COLOUR

This workshop opens us up to the use of colour when working with the human form.  Using at least 2 different coloured media, will discuss skin tones, shadows and reflected light.  We will explore some interesting colour-based warmups, and then work with longer poses to build up richer and more complex drawings.

WEEK 4:  COMPLETION

This workshop will provide participants with the opportunity to tie together the skills practiced in weeks 1-3.  We will discuss principles of composition, and practice executing a drawing in full, including tricky areas like faces, hands and feet. Participants will be free to use the materials of their choice in this session.
